- // OK, `const (const i32)` is the same type as `const i32`.
- // CHECK:STDERR: collapse.carbon:[[@LINE+4]]:25: warning: `const` applied repeatedly to the same type has no additional effect [RepeatedConst]
- // CHECK:STDERR: fn F(p: const i32**) -> const (const i32)** {
- // CHECK:STDERR: ^~~~~~~~~~~~~~~~~
- // CHECK:STDERR:
- fn F(p: const i32**) -> const (const i32)** {
- return p;
- }
